Planning appeal decision
Pavement at Entrance To Westgate Shopping Centre, Castle Street, Oxford, OX1 1HH
the installation of 1no. BT Street Hub and removal of associated existing BT payphone(s)

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- the effect of the hub and its digital display on the character and appearance and visual amenity of the surrounding area, including the nearby Central Conservation Area
- whether the proposals would preserve the setting of the Grade II listed 29A Castle Street and a non-designated heritage asset
- the effect of the proposals on public safety and crime
What decided it
The proposal would not harm the character and appearance of the surrounding area or the setting of nearby heritage assets, and public safety concerns could be adequately managed through conditions securing the Anti-social Behaviour Management Plan.
Plan policies cited: Policy DH1, Policy V9, Policy DH6, Policy DH3
